In 2009 the legendary British rock band Matsumoto Leiji on the production of their first video using Japanese animation.

The video combines Queen's signature song Bohemian Rhapsody with concepts from Out of Galaxy Koshika, a manga from Matsumoto and Sunsoft which started distribution through Nintendo Wii's Shopping Channel on April 14, 2009. The manga's story begins in Tokyo on September 9, 2099. A dimensional ship, under the command of a beautiful woman named Haguro You, launches into space to save Earth from imminent annihilation. A young boy named Umino Hajime finds himself coming aboard for the adventure that unfolds. Secrets are revealed about Hajime and a silver cat pendant with an unknown power.

Part of the video was unveiled on 24 November, 2009 — the 18th anniversary of former Queen lead singer Freddie Mercury's ing — in special events in Tokyo and Osaka. The full video became available on Japanese mobile phone distribution sites on December 23.

* Based on the Japanese folk tale Nezumi no Sumo (ねずみのすもう).

A farmer witnesses the sumo match of his house's mice and is disappointed when they lose horribly. He and his wife prepare a feast to help the mice train for their next match. The next night, they go to see how their mice fare against the competition...

Note: The seventh in a series of short films produced to screen exclusively at the Studio Ghibli Museum in Japan. There has been no commercial release for this film, which premiered at the museum's Saturn Theater on 3 January 2010.

* Sora no Oto was created as a multimedia mix project and the first entry in Aniplex and TV Tokyo's Anime no Chikara project.

Set in the future on a land that, after being marred by long-lasting wars, has settled into a quiet cycle of decline. Sorami Kanata is a 15-year-old girl who fulfills her dream of enlisting in the army and s a unit of five girls who protect a fortress that looms over a little village. The girls also play music that reverberates across the skies over towns without people and seas without fish.

Note: This title is reported as using the Spanish city of Cuenca and its nearby Alarcón Fortress as a model for the storyline.

The legendary swordsmith Shikizaki Kiki made 1000 swords in his career. The more of these swords a state had, the greater the success in battle. When the Shogun emerged victorious, he collected 988 of the swords... but those were only the swordsmith's inferior practice pieces. For the final twelve swords were the pinnacle of his career. Each of them has powers so extraordinary, that one man wielding one of them could defeat a small army.

Shogunate strategist Togame has been ordered to recover all of them. She first hired a ninja... but the worth of the swords is so great the entire ninja clan defected the moment they recovered one. Then she hired a swordsman... though bound by honour, he felt he should keep the sword for himself.

Her last hope is Shichika, the seventh and last practitioner of the Kyotoryuu — the No Sword School. He and his sister live on an island cut off from civilization — so they have no need or use for money. His sword school does not use swords either — so he would not want the swords for himself.

So why should he help Togame?

"Because you will fall in love with me."

* Based on the satirical mahjong manga by Oowada Hideki originally serialised in the Kindai Mahjong Original manga magazine published by Takeshobo, then switched to bimonthly serialisation on Takeshobo's other mahjong manga magazine Kindai Mahjong in April 2009.

The premise of the story is that international diplomacy is settled on the mahjong table, with real-life politicians depicted as masters of mahjong. The title, Mudazumo Naki Kaikaku (Reform with no Wasted Draws), is a parody of Koizumi Jun'ichirou's slogan, "Seiiki Naki Kaikaku" (Reform with no Sanctuary, 聖域無き改革).

Although based on real-life politicians, the characters are, as the disclaimer notes, "works of fiction and not really related to any real-life people".
